Lorenzo Abrogar Gamboa was a Filipino-American man who was excluded from Australia under the White Australia policy, despite having an Australian wife and children. His treatment sparked an international incident with the Philippines.
Lorenzo and Joyce Gamboa, 1943
Gamboa married Joyce Cain in Melbourne on 9 October 1943.
